The Crucial Role of N-Ethyl-p-toluidine in Modern Organic Synthesis
N-Ethyl-p-toluidine, identified by its CAS number 622-57-1, stands as a cornerstone in the field of organic synthesis. As a specialized chemical intermediate, its unique molecular structure and reactivity make it an indispensable component in the creation of a wide array of complex molecules. Understanding the properties and applications of this compound is crucial for researchers and manufacturers aiming to optimize their production processes.
One of the primary uses of N-Ethyl-p-toluidine lies in its role as a precursor for dyes. Its incorporation into synthesis pathways allows for the creation of vibrant and stable colorants used across various industries, including textiles, printing, and plastics. Beyond coloration, N-Ethyl-p-toluidine is also a significant intermediate in the pharmaceutical sector. It contributes to the synthesis of active pharmaceutical ingredients (APIs), playing a part in the development of life-saving medicines. Furthermore, the agrochemical industry benefits from the utility of N-Ethyl-p-toluidine. It serves as a building block for pesticides and other crop protection agents, aiding in agricultural productivity and food security. For professionals working with this chemical, adherence to safe handling of N-Ethyl-p-toluidine is paramount. Its toxic and flammable nature necessitates strict safety protocols. This includes proper storage in cool, well-ventilated areas, away from incompatible materials, and the use of appropriate personal protective equipment (PPE) during handling and processing.
